1. Mastering the Fundamentals of Data Entry
Successful remote data entry requires more than just fast typing. Accuracy is paramount. Errors can have significant consequences, leading to project delays and even financial losses. Therefore, honing your typing skills and developing a keen eye for detail are fundamental.
1.1. Improving Your Typing Speed and Accuracy
Practice makes perfect. Utilize online typing tutors like TypingClub or Ratatype to increase your words-per-minute (WPM) and accuracy rate. Aim for at least 60 WPM with minimal errors for entry-level positions.
1.2. Developing a Sharp Eye for Detail
Data entry often involves meticulous attention to detail. Regularly perform proofreading exercises to enhance your ability to spot inconsistencies and errors. Consider using tools like Grammarly to further refine your accuracy.
2. Choosing the Right Remote Data Entry Tools and Software
Efficient data entry relies heavily on the right tools. Familiarize yourself with various software and tools to streamline your workflow.
2.1. Essential Software and Applications
Master spreadsheet software like Microsoft Excel and Google Sheets. Learn keyboard shortcuts to significantly boost your efficiency. Familiarity with data entry specific software, like those used for medical transcription or accounting data, is a huge plus.
2.2. Utilizing Productivity Tools
Explore time management apps like Trello or Asana to organize projects and track progress. Utilizing cloud storage solutions like Google Drive or Dropbox allows for easy access and collaboration.
3. Finding Legitimate Remote Data Entry Jobs
Scams are prevalent in the remote work industry. It’s crucial to identify legitimate opportunities.
3.1. Identifying Legitimate Job Boards
Avoid sites promising unrealistic earnings or upfront payments. Instead, focus on reputable job boards such as Indeed, LinkedIn, and FlexJobs, which often screen for fraudulent listings.
3.2. Vetting Potential Employers
Thoroughly research any potential employer before applying. Check their online reviews, and be wary of companies demanding fees for application or training. Always confirm the legitimacy of the company’s registration.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
Q1: How much can I earn doing remote data entry? Earnings vary greatly depending on experience, location, and the type of data entry work. Entry-level positions may offer hourly rates ranging from $10-$15, while experienced professionals can earn significantly more.
Q2: What are the best remote data entry companies? Many reputable companies offer remote data entry positions. Research and vet potential employers carefully to ensure legitimacy. Some well-known companies include Lionbridge and Amazon Mechanical Turk (though the latter is more task-based). [Link to Lionbridge Careers] [Link to Amazon Mechanical Turk]
Q3: Do I need any specific qualifications for remote data entry? While a high school diploma or equivalent is typically sufficient for entry-level positions, advanced skills such as proficiency in specific software or medical transcription can increase earning potential.
Q4: How can I protect myself from scams? Always be wary of companies that require upfront payments, guarantee unrealistic earnings, or request personal information before offering a formal job offer. Look for verifiable online reviews from previous employees.
